Today many churches and worship spaces are not necessarily designed acoustical spaces, they are often“ tilt up” improvised spaces that need to be set up on the fly in schools, auditorium’ s, converted industrial spaces etc. This is a common challenge for churches rehearsing in acoustically less than perfect reflective rooms or multipurpose halls. The LS-208’ s strong off-axis rejection keeps the focus on the source, reducing room reflections and background clutter. For teams improving livestream mixes or in-ear clarity without major acoustic treatment, the LS-208’ s focused pickup pattern is a game changer.
The LS-208’ s output level is slightly lower than some condenser microphones, so it will benefit from being connected to a clean, high-gain preamp, something most modern worship consoles provide. For vocals, a pop filter is recommended to guard against“ plosives”. To get the best vocal sound from the LS- 208, using the included windscreen is highly recommended. You can always take it off and use it with a pop filter if you want, but the overall sound will be a lot brighter if you use the included windscreen.
